A delightful twist on the classic pumpkin cheesecake, this recipe combines creamy textures with the warm flavors of pumpkin spice, perfect for any occasion.
In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th and creamy.
Ensure the cream cheese is at room temperature to avoid lumps.
Add the pureed pumpkin, granulated sugar, and pumpkin pie spice to the cream cheese and mix until well combined.
Taste the mixture and adjust the spice level to your preference.
Gently fold in the thawed whipped topping using a spatula until the mixture is light and fluffy.
Fold gently to maintain the airy texture of the filling.
Spoon the filling into the prepared graham cracker crust, spreading it evenly.
Use the back of a spoon to smooth the top for a neat finish.
Refrigerate the cheesecake for at least 3 hours or until set.
For best results, let it chill overnight to fully set.
Serve the cheesecake chilled, garnished with additional whipped topping or a sprinkle of pumpkin pie spice.
Add a drizzle of caramel sauce for an extra touch of sweetness.
